Free drum kit samples!

Recorded at Warren Street Studio, the samples are provided in three different packs, close mic’ed, room ambience and mixed. You can find them here, all in 44.1kHz/24bit stereo AIFF. Oh, and they’re excellent by the way. Say thank you!

Free samples from Goldbaby

Goldbaby is probably one of the hottest names in the sampling scene right now, offering mostly smallish sets that address very specific needs. Yeah, everybody’s got plenty of 808 samples but theirs is recorded to vintage tape, or sampled through the venerable mpc60’s converters. In fact analog tape saturation and vintage sampler crunch are among the most sought after effects nowadays, probably also due to the lack of a real alternative in the digital world. Excellent quality, distinctive sound, nice price, variety of formats: it doesn’t get much better than this when buying samples i’m afraid.

Their free download page is just the icing on the cake.
